"1836-1904: A Journey through Immortality and Artistic Brilliance" Step into the world of Henri Fantin-Latour, a French artist who lived from 1836 to 1904. During his lifetime, he created an exquisite collection of masterpieces that continue to captivate art enthusiasts today. One such masterpiece is "1886, " a painting that embodies the concept of immortality. Through delicate brushstrokes and vibrant colors, Fantin-Latour transports us to a realm where time stands still, allowing us to glimpse eternity. In "XXVII" and "XXI, " we witness the artist's ability to capture human emotions with remarkable precision. Each stroke reveals the depth of feeling within his subjects' eyes, leaving us mesmerized by their silent stories. Fantin-Latour's talent extends beyond portraiture as seen in works like "The Muse. " Here, he explores mythical themes with grace and elegance. The ethereal beauty depicted in "Venus and Cupid" and "Venus Anadyomene" showcases his mastery over capturing divine forms on canvas. With pieces like "Vision, " we are transported into dreamlike landscapes where reality merges seamlessly with imagination. These visionary creations invite contemplation and provoke introspection about our own perceptions of the world around us. "The Flying Dutchman" takes us on a journey through mythological realms filled with mystery and enchantment. Fantin-Latour's attention to detail brings this legendary tale alive before our very eyes. Nature also finds its place in his repertoire; in paintings such as "The Spring, " we witness nature awakening from its slumber as flowers bloom under gentle sunlight, and is a celebration of life itself captured on canvas. Finally, in works like "Twilight of the Gods: Siegfried and the Rhine Maidens, " Fantin-Latour delves into Wagnerian opera themes with dramatic flair.
